    Here are two ideas Kandi!

    Place a smaller pot inside a larger pot and fill the area between the two containers with pebbles or rocks. You can also use a wider or longer planter and arrange several pots inside, filling in the space with soil, rocks or pebbles.

    Arrange pots against a fence, deck rail or another structure that can help keep them upright in heavy winds. You can also arrange them next to a windbreak, such as against a solid fence or along a wall. Pots are also less likely to tip over if you place them in a corner or group them together.
